Brazing grinding tool with diamond lines arranged at intervals
By using a brazed abrasive tool with diamond lines spaced apart, and by employing a top seat, snap-fit blocks, and a ring-shaped magnetic plate, the problems of cumbersome installation and stripped screws in traditional brazed abrasive tools are solved. This enables rapid installation and disassembly, and improves the wear resistance and service life of the abrasive tool.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to brazing abrasive tool technical field, concretely is a kind of diamond line interval arrangement's brazing abrasive tool. BACKGROUND
[0002] Brazing abrasive tool is a kind of abrasive tool that superhard abrasive (such as CBN etc.) is firmly combined in matrix using brazing process.In brazing process, metal material with lower melting point than base material is used as filler metal, and the filler metal is melted and wets the base material under specific temperature, and the joint gap is filled by capillary action, to realize the chemical metallurgical combination between abrasive and matrix.This combination makes abrasive firmly fixed on matrix, and it is not easy to fall off even under high-speed heavy load working condition.Brazing abrasive tool has high abrasive exposure rate, large chip space, not easy to block and high sharpness, and is particularly suitable for high-speed rough machining and machining of materials prone to sticking and blocking.Common brazing abrasive tools include brazed bond grinding wheel, brazed abrasive sheet, slice, grinding head, drill bit etc.;
[0003] However, the traditional brazing abrasive tool is connected with the equipment by thread connection, which is relatively cumbersome to install and disassemble, and the screw is prone to slipping under long-term screwing, increasing the cost investment of the equipment.To solve the above problems, the inventor proposes a kind of diamond line interval arrangement's brazing abrasive tool. [0019] Example: Figures 1-4 As shown, this utility model provides a brazing abrasive tool with diamond lines arranged at intervals, including an abrasive body 1. A conical column 2 is fixedly connected to the top of the abrasive body 1, and a top seat 3 is fixedly connected to the top of the conical column 2. The upper and lower surfaces of the top seat 3 are both set as inclined surfaces. A connecting seat 4 is provided at the top of the abrasive body 1. An installation groove 5 is opened inside the connecting seat 4. The conical column 2 and the top seat 3 are movably inserted into the installation groove 5. A sliding groove 6 is opened inside the abrasive body 1 on both sides of the installation groove 5. A locking block 7 is slidably engaged inside the sliding groove 6 and engages with the top seat 3. By inserting the conical column 2 and the top seat 3 into the installation groove 5 and engaging the top seat 3 with the locking block 7, the vertical movement of the conical column 2 is limited.
[0020] A guide rod 8 is fixedly connected to the side of the snap-fit block 7 away from the top seat 3. A spring 10 is provided between the side of the snap-fit block 7 near the guide rod 8 and the inner wall of the slide groove 6. The spring 10 is movably sleeved on the outside of the guide rod 8.
[0021] By adopting the above technical solution, when installing the mold body 1, the spring 10 is set to facilitate the reset of the snap-fit block 7. At the same time, the elastic force of the spring 10 makes the snap-fit block 7 and the top seat 3 more securely snap-fitted together.
[0022] The end of the guide rod 8 away from the snap-fit block 7 extends movably to the outside of the connecting seat 4 and is fixedly connected to the limit block 9.
[0023] By adopting the above technical solution and setting the limiting block 9, it is convenient to limit the lateral movement of the locking block 7, and prevent the locking block 7 from sliding out of the inside of the slide groove 6 when the conical column 2 is pulled out.
[0024] The bottom end of the connecting seat 4 is fixedly connected with a ring-shaped magnetic plate one 11, and the top end of the abrasive tool body 1 is fixedly connected with a ring-shaped magnetic plate two 12, and the ring-shaped magnetic plate one 11 and the ring-shaped magnetic plate two 12 attract each other.
[0025] By adopting the above technical scheme, the abrasive tool body 1 is installed more firmly through the mutual attraction between the ring-shaped magnetic plate one 11 and the ring-shaped magnetic plate two 12.
[0026] Two symmetrically distributed positioning grooves 14 are arranged at the top end of the inner wall of the mounting groove 5, and the top end of the top seat 3 is fixedly connected with two symmetrically distributed positioning rods 13, and the top end of the positioning rod 13 is movably inserted into the positioning groove 14.
[0027] By adopting the above technical scheme, the abrasive tool body 1 is positioned through the cooperation between the positioning rod 13 and the positioning groove 14, so as to prevent the relative rotation between the abrasive tool body 1 and the connecting seat 4.
[0028] The outer surface of the abrasive tool body 1 is brazed with diamond abrasives 15 arranged in line intervals.
[0029] By adopting the above technical scheme, the diamond abrasives 15 arranged in line intervals are brazed on the outer surface of the abrasive tool body 1, which significantly improves the wear resistance of the abrasive tool, thereby prolonging the service life thereof.
[0030] Working principle: when the brazed abrasive tool is used, the diamond abrasives 15 arranged in line intervals are brazed on the outer surface of the abrasive tool body 1, which significantly improves the wear resistance of the abrasive tool, thereby prolonging the service life thereof;
[0031] When the abrasive tool is installed with the connecting seat, the conical column 2 at the top end of the abrasive tool body 1 and the top seat 3 are inserted into the inside of the mounting groove 5, and the positioning rod 13 corresponds to the position of the positioning groove 14, when the top end of the top seat 3 is in contact with the clamping block 7, the two clamping blocks 7 are simultaneously pushed to move to one side of the spring 10, when the top seat 3 moves to the bottom end and corresponds to the position of the clamping block 7, the spring 10 is used to push the clamping block 7 to move to one side of the top seat 3, so that the clamping block 7 and the top seat 3 are clamped with each other, thereby limiting the pulling out of the abrasive tool body 1, at the same time, the ring-shaped magnetic plate one 11 and the ring-shaped magnetic plate two 12 attract each other, so that the abrasive tool body 1 is installed more firmly, at this time, the positioning rod 13 is inserted into the inside of the positioning groove 14, which limits the relative rotation between the abrasive tool body 1 and the connecting seat 4, and the installation of the abrasive tool body 1 is completed.
[0032] When the abrasive tool body 1 needs to be disassembled, by applying appropriate force to the abrasive tool body 1, the top seat 3 and the conical column 2 can be pulled out from the inside of the mounting groove 5 through the cooperation between the bottom end of the top seat 3 and the clamping block 7, thereby completing the disassembly of the abrasive tool body 1.
